Indian Freediving Athlete Soham Chatterjee Sets Two National Records at the Singapore International Freediving Championship 2023 completed yesterday. 

 

Soham Chatterjee, a talented freediving athlete hailing from Kolkata, West Bengal, made India proud at the Singapore International Freediving Championship 2023. Competing in the prestigious event organised by the CMAS Singapore, Soham showcased his remarkable skills and determination.

 

In the Static Freediving category, Soham Chatterjee achieved an incredible milestone, setting a new national record for India with a breath-holding time of 4 minutes and 31 seconds. This achievement not only demonstrates Soham's remarkable lung capacity and composure but also puts India firmly on the map of competitive freediving.

Soham's excellence didn't stop there. He also made waves in the Indoor Dynamic Freediving category using bi fins, covering a distance of 75 metres. This outstanding performance secured him yet another new national record, further solidifying his position as a top freediving athlete in India.

Both of these national records have been officially validated by CMAS SINGAPORE and CMAS INDIA, the sole representative of the World Underwater Federation - CMAS in India. CMAS, recognized by the International Olympic Committee and serving as the global governing body of freediving, adds international prestige to Soham's accomplishments.


Soham Chatterjee's success is the result of years of hard work and dedication, and it highlights the potential of Indian athletes in the world of freediving. His remarkable achievements in Singapore serve as an inspiration to aspiring freedivers across India and a testament to the nation's growing prominence in this exhilarating underwater sport.
